Your multifunction printer can become a useful asset in managing and controlling costs for printing and imaging, and can also add new capabilities to your organization if you choose wisely. TCO can also increase significantly for devices that are hard to use and maintain, unreliable, or lack the features and capability to efficiently and effectively produce the results you need. Once ink costs are taken into consideration, inkjet multifunction printers, initially perceived as being low-cost, often turn out to have an equivalent or higher TCO than the better-performing laser multifunction printers. There are a number of other factors to consider, including the cost of supplies. When evaluating a multifunction printer, beware of looking only at the cost of the initial hardware.
